Creamy Baked Feta Salmon

Creamy Baked Feta Salmon: 5 Delicious Secrets


  • Author: basmer
  • Total Time: 45 min
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A comforting and flavorful dish featuring creamy feta and perfectly cooked salmon combined with pasta for a delightful me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z pasta (penne or your choice)
  • 1 block feta cheese
  • 2 salmon fillets
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h basil or par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Grease a baking dish and drizzle a tablespoon of olive oil.
  3. Place the feta block in the center of the dish, surrounded by cherry tomatoes. Drizzle with remaining olive oil, and season with oregano, salt, and pepper.
  4. Bake for about 25 minutes until the feta is golden and soft.
  5. Cook the pasta in salted water according to package instructions until al dente.
  6. Prepare the salmon by seasoning it and searing in a pan for about 3–4 minutes per side.
  7. Add the cooked garlic to the hot tomatoes and feta.
  8. Add the drained pasta into the baking dish, flake the salmon on top, and lightly mix.
  9. Garnish with fresh basil or parsley.
  10. Serve hot and enjoy!
